How to Properly Care for and Maintain Boots for Climbing Ladders
Properly caring for and maintaining boots for climbing ladders is crucial to ensure their longevity and performance. One of the most important steps is to clean the boot regularly. The boot should be cleaned with a soft brush and mild soap to remove dirt and debris. Additionally, the boot should also be dried thoroughly after cleaning to prevent moisture from accumulating and causing damage.
Another important step is to condition the boot. The boot should be conditioned with a leather conditioner or waterproofing spray to protect the material and prevent cracking or fading. Furthermore, the boot should also be stored in a cool, dry place to prevent moisture from accumulating and causing damage. By storing the boot in a cool, dry place, individuals can help extend its lifespan and maintain its performance.
In addition to these steps, the boot should also be inspected regularly for signs of wear and tear. The sole should be inspected for signs of wear, such as cracks or holes, and the ankle support should be inspected for signs of damage, such as cracks or breaks. If any signs of wear or tear are found, the boot should be replaced immediately to ensure safety and comfort. By inspecting the boot regularly, individuals can help identify potential problems before they become major issues.

Can I use hiking boots for climbing ladders?
While hiking boots can provide excellent support and traction, they may not be the best choice for climbing ladders. Hiking boots are designed for walking and hiking on uneven terrain, and may not provide the same level of grip and traction on smooth ladder rungs. Additionally, hiking boots may be too bulky or heavy for ladder climbing, which can make them more difficult to maneuver.
If you plan to climb ladders frequently, it’s generally recommended to invest in a pair of boots specifically designed for ladder climbing. These boots will typically have a more aggressive tread pattern and a lower profile, which can make them easier to use on ladders. However, if you only need to climb ladders occasionally, a pair of hiking boots may be sufficient. Just be sure to inspect the boots carefully before use, and consider adding additional traction devices or accessories to improve grip and stability.
